Expert Care from a Leader in the Field

 

In the world of EMDR, there is a difference between being 'trained' and being Certified. As an EMDRIA-Approved Consultant, I mentor other therapists in this work, and as Faculty, I help teach the model nationally. For you, this means receiving therapy from a clinician who is deeply committed to the highest standards of clinical excellence.
